Phrases like:
- “STOP STARING”
- “TRY THESE 3 SEEDS”
- “AGE 70+”
are commonly used in misleading ads or social media bait posts that try to push a “miracle cure” or supplement idea without evidence.
What you should know
- There are no “3 seeds” that can reverse aging or fix eyesight, memory, or serious health issues as those posts often imply.
- Real nutrition benefits come from a balanced diet, not secret combinations.
- If it were a genuine medical breakthrough, it would be supported by clinical studies and medical institutions, not dramatic slogans.
Why these posts exist
They’re usually designed to:
- Grab attention with urgency or fear (“STOP!”)
- Target older people (“AGE 70+”)
- Push supplements, ads, or affiliate links
Bottom line
Treat messages like this as marketing noise, not medical advice.
